Historical Overview

Origins and Construction (1902–1921)

Commissioned at the dawn of the 20th century, the Frederick K. Stearns House was intended to reflect both the stature and artistic inclinations of its owner. Frederick K. Stearns was not only a business leader—helming Frederick Stearns & Company, a leading pharmaceutical firm—but also a supporter of the arts and Detroit’s early baseball scene (frederickstearns.com/history; detroit1701.org; wikipedia).

Architects William Stratton and Frank C. Baldwin delivered a two-and-one-half-story mansion that combined Medieval and Arts and Crafts elements. The house’s hollow tile structure, timbered and stuccoed façades, varied window designs, and steep gabled roofs created a distinctive, storybook character (historicdetroit.org).

The Stearns Family and Their Legacy

Frederick K. Stearns inherited his father’s pharmaceutical empire and played a pivotal role in Detroit’s industrial and cultural development. His love for music was reflected in the grand music room, which once housed his collection of musical instruments—many now part of the University of Michigan’s renowned Stearns Collection (frederickstearns.com/history).

Architectural Significance & Features

The Stearns House is a masterpiece of Tudor Revival and Arts and Crafts design, recognized on the National Register of Historic Places since 1985 (wikipedia). Noteworthy features include:

  • Half-timbered and Stuccoed Façades: Classic Tudor styling with visible timber framing.
  • Steep Gabled Roofs and Tall Chimneys: Striking rooflines and decorative chimney pots.
  • Stained and Painted Glass Windows: Artful details that filter natural light and add vibrancy.
  • Pewabic and Moravian Tilework: Lavish fireplaces and decorative accents from renowned artisans (frederickstearns.com/history).
  • Grand Music Room and Carriage House: Spaces reflecting Stearns’ passions and the lifestyle of Detroit’s elite.

Restoration and Revival (2018–2022)

From 2018 to 2022, owners Eric and Rachel Mitchell led a top-to-bottom restoration, carefully preserving original elements like tile fireplaces, stained glass, and carved woodwork (historicdetroit.org). Today, the house functions as a boutique inn, event venue, and living museum, featuring themed guest rooms, a speakeasy-style pub, and spaces for cultural gatherings (frederickstearns.com).
